I own an agency and I do not solicit clients who are looking for state minimum insurance which is what I see when I read "cheapest". I would say that my book had maybe a half dozen clients with state minimum and those were from my early days. I sell a lot of 100/300 but primarily 250/500 as that is the market I chose to work. Those clients have assets, realize the value of insurance, and tend to stay for many years.

Think about where you want to be long term and the kind of book you want to build. In Texas, your 30/60 clients will leave you for a dollar a month. Not worth it in my opinion. Go for clients that you can develop a long term relationship with.
